Extraction, Partial Characterization and Electorspinning of Acid-soluble Collagen and Pepsin-soluble Collagen From Mylopharyngodon Piceus Swim Bladder

摘要

Black Carp (Mylopharyngodon piceus) is one of the main species of freshwater fish produced in China.Acid-soluble collagens (ASC) and pepsin-soluble collagen (PSC) were prepared from the swim bladder of the black carp.The yield of ASC and PSC were 6.9% and 12.5% (wet weight basis),respectively.According to the SDS-PAGE electrophoretic pattern and H-NMR,both collagens contained α-and β-chains as their major components,and were characterized as type Ⅰ collagen with the cross-link of two α-chain.Collagen dissolved in hexafluoroisopropanol (HFIP) were electrospun.It's found that diameter of fibers is related to the addition of the collagen,positive voltage,the distance between aluminum foil and needle,as well as the flow rate of the solution.Because collagen can stop bleeding quickly,so the fibers can be used as medical hemostatic materials.The results also suggest that the swim bladder of black carp collagens have potential as an alternative source of collagen for use in various fields.
